What is a Kitchen Extractor Fan?
A kitchen extractor fan, likewise referred to as a range hood or cooker hood, is designed to get rid of airborne grease, smoke, steam, and smells produced during cooking. By drawing in air, filtering it, and then venting it outside or recirculating it, these fans ensure a tidy and enjoyable cooking environment.

Types of Kitchen Extractor Fans
When it pertains to picking a kitchen extractor fan, understanding the various types available can considerably affect buying choices:
Wall-Mounted Extractor Hoods
- Mounted straight to the wall above the cooktop.
- Offered in various styles and surfaces.
Under-Cabinet Extractor Hoods
- Set up beneath kitchen cabinets, ideal for smaller sized spaces.
- Typically included a convertible alternative for external and recirculating ventilation.
Island Extractor Hoods
- Created for kitchens with a center island cooktop.
- Uses a complete ventilation option with a sensational overhead design.
Integrated or Integrated Extractor Hoods
- Hidden within cabinets for a smooth look.
- Blends perfectly with kitchen style for a sophisticated appearance.
Downdraft Extractors
- Retractable designs that rise from behind the cooktop.
- Popular for open-plan designs and minimalist visual appeals.
Considerations When Choosing a Kitchen Extractor Fan
Selecting the right kitchen extractor fan includes numerous factors to consider to ensure optimum efficiency and looks. Here's a checklist of elements to assess:
| Consideration | Information |
|---|---|
| Size and Capacity | Select a fan that matches cooktop width; usually, the CFM score need to be 100 CFM for each 10,000 BTUs of cooking power. |
| Ducted vs. Ductless | Ducted is generally more efficient but requires installation work, while ductless is much easier to establish but requires regular filter modifications. |
| Noise Level | Search for fans with lower sones (a procedure of sound); quieter alternatives are perfect for open-concept spaces. |
| Design and Finish | Consider the kitchen's overall style-- pick a surface that complements existing devices and design. |
| Reduce of Cleaning | Choose detachable filters and smooth finishes that decrease upkeep efforts. |
| Budget plan | Establish a spending plan, remembering that higher-end models frequently offer improved features. |
Installation and Maintenance
Correct setup and maintenance of your kitchen extractor fan are necessary for optimum efficiency. Here are some general setup guidelines:
- Location: The fan needs to preferably be installed 26-30 inches above the cooktop.
- Expert Installation: For ducted models, working with an expert installer is advised to make sure venting is done correctly.
- Regular Maintenance: Clean filters every 30 days and replace them as required to prevent air flow obstruction and maintain efficiency.
Upkeep Tips
- Clean the Exterior: Use mild soap and water for stainless-steel surfaces to keep them smudge-free.
- Inspect Ducts: Regularly check ducts for clogs or grease buildup.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I understand what size extractor fan I require?
The size of the extractor fan need to normally match the width of your cooktop. In addition, think about the fan's CFM (cubic feet per minute) score in relation to your cooking power. A suggested formula is 100 CFM for each 10,000 BTUs.
2. Can I set up an extractor fan myself?
For ductless designs, setup can be uncomplicated. Nevertheless, for ducted designs, employing a professional is suggested to ensure appropriate venting and compliance with regional building codes.
3. How often should I clean the fan filters?
It's generally recommended to clean grease filters every 30 days, while charcoal filters need to be replaced around every 6 months, or more frequently if you cook typically.
4. Do kitchen extractor fans require a great deal of energy?
Modern extractor fans are designed to be energy-efficient, taking in less power while supplying efficient ventilation. Look for ENERGY STAR-rated models for better performance.
